
Enable job alerts via email!
A global technology company is seeking a Vice President of Product Management to lead consumer credit card initiatives in the EEMEA region. This strategic role involves managing a high-performing team, developing tailored product strategies, and establishing key partnerships to enhance Mastercard's market presence. The ideal candidate will have over 15 years' experience in product management and a strong track record in financial services.
Our Purpose
Mastercard powers economies and empowers people in 200+ countries and territories worldwide. Together with our customers, we’re helping build a sustainable economy where everyone can prosper. We support a wide range of digital payments choices, making transactions secure, simple, smart and accessible. Our technology and innovation, partnerships and networks combine to deliver a unique set of products and services that help people, businesses and governments realize their greatest potential.
Vice President, Product Management, Credit
Mastercard is seeking a strategic and visionary leader to head Product Management for Consumer Credit Cards across Eastern Europe, Middle East, and Africa (EEMEA). This role is central to driving innovation, market leadership, and customer‑centric delivery in one of the most diverse and high‑potential regions globally.
As Vice President, you will lead a high‑performing team to shape Mastercard’s credit card portfolio, build strategic partnerships, and deliver differentiated solutions across key consumer segments—such as affluent, travel‑savvy, and everyday spenders. You will be responsible for accelerating growth, enhancing profitability, and positioning Mastercard as the preferred credit card brand in the region.
You will drive ideation conception, business plan development, research and validation of ideas and implementation of new programs and features that support the Mastercard offering.
All activities involving access to Mastercard assets, information, and networks comes with an inherent risk to the organization and, therefore, it is expected that every person working for, or on behalf of, Mastercard is responsible for information security and must :
Abide by Mastercard’s security policies and practices;
Ensure the confidentiality and integrity of the information being accessed;
Report any suspected information security violation or breach, and
Complete all periodic mandatory security trainings in accordance with Mastercard’s guidelines.